Episode 78--Don't Let Your Mind Drive the Bus

Ever feel like your mind has a mind of its own? In this episode, we explore Bhagavad Gita 6.6, where Krishna says the mind can either be our greatest friend or our worst enemy. We’ll unpack what the mind really is, why it often misleads us, and how to take back the steering wheel through conscious, spiritual living.

Using metaphors, real-life examples, and Gita-based insights, we’ll look at:

  • How the soul, mind, and body interact

  • Why unchecked thoughts lead to regret, confusion, and even self-sabotage

  • How to stop letting the mind run the show

  • Practical ways to engage the mind with intention and devotion

  • What it really means to follow Krishna—not just the mind

If you're tired of being dragged around by impulses, worries, or distractions, this conversation is for you. Let’s learn how to gently take back control and train the mind to support—not sabotage—our higher purpose.
